Key ceremony checklist, item 7 — Fernvale config hot-reload. Reviewer: before signing off, confirm the new signing keys propagate via hot-reload without a service restart; watch the Larkspur config daemon logs for a clean swap. If the daemon refuses the reload (stale lease, usually), you'll have to unlock the ceremony escrow box and re-run step 4. The escrow unlock needs the recovery passphrase, which is recorded immediately below this item.

unlock words, yawig-kagef: gordor-holvan-ulaael-pramir-ulaiel-tamdor

**Action Item (P2):** During the Shelfwright outage, the Lumastock barcode scanner integration silently dropped scans when the decoder queue backed up, and warehouse staff had no visual indication. We need a retry buffer plus an operator-facing error banner in the handheld app. Please coordinate with Priya on the decoder team before changing queue limits, since Lumastock firmware has strict timing assumptions. Full context, diagrams, and the agreed rollout plan are on the internal page below.

wiki page, hahif-hahif: https://argocd.kelvisys.corp/browse/board/settings/pages/1442e0b1065d83f1

## Deployment

Starting with Quillbench 3.0, the report builder guarantees stable sorting across shards: rows with equal keys retain their ingest order. Plugin authors who previously re-sorted output as a workaround can remove that logic. Note that stability is only guaranteed when the merge coordinator runs in strict mode, which is the shipped default. The deployment enables this via the following settings.

config for tawif-bagef:
[sorwyn]
team = sorys
access_code = ac_9ba40c
host = sorwyn.ordingrid.local
port = 5000
owner = aldok.quenion
peer = belath.paliqcloud.local

The garage occupancy feed for the Brindlewood campus arrives over a message queue every thirty seconds, one record per level, published by the Stallgrid edge boxes. Counts can briefly go negative when a sensor double-fires on exit; the ingest job clamps these to zero and flags the interval. If the feed stalls for more than five minutes, the dashboard falls back to the last known snapshot. Sensor mappings, queue names, and the replay procedure are documented on the internal page below.

runbook for tahog-kadug: https://gitlab.qirvanworks.corp/projects/pages/view/b139298aed28